Continuing Education General Information
Course Cancellations
Early registration is recommended for all courses as class sizes are limited. Some classes may be cancelled up to 48 hours prior if there is insufficient enrolment.
Refund Policy
(refer to www.douglascollege.ca/programs/continuing-education for complete details)
Full refunds will be issued if the College cancels a course. Refunds are available to persons who withdraw from a course and request a refund from Continuing Education three (3) working days prior to the start of any course. Some exceptions apply (eg. JCLT). Check individual program information.
Note: A $15 processing fee will be charged. No refund will be issued if course fees or the refund amount is less than $15. Fees for materials, supplies, books, etc. are not eligible for refunds.
Receipts for Income Tax purposes issued. Official transcripts and certificates available.
